The former version of www.capacity4dev.eu generated a lot of traffic but was not actively used. The website grew organically and had a lot of nice functionalities but without any vision or concept. In general, when you arrived as a new visitor, it was not clear at all what C4D stands for. Why has this website been created? What can you do with it? How can you do it? What is the target audience? What is currently going on?
In addition, it lacked of usability, a lot of features were set up in the wrong place or didn’t work at all. The former design was professional but overloaded.
Other problems: search was not well implemented, complex forms and workflows, poor navigation structure and lack of a personal dashboard.
Technically, the former C4D platform gave a buggy, unstable impression. Due to the big number of modules used (>290), the system became un-maintainable.
After a analysis phase together with our partner Namahn, the new Capacity4dev.eu project was described as:
· Base the new C4D platform on user needs, with a focus on an ergonomic design. Provide a new, intuitive user interface, with a well balanced taxonomy and improved navigation that help users accomplish their goals.
· Based on the Strategy for capacity4dev.eu, expand the thematic scope of the platform to allow all thematic Units and Issues to be covered.
· Work on improving the core functionality, the backbone of C4D, i.e. offer group ware to professionals with a common interest that allows them to share knowledge and information in a safe environment. Less is more: reduce the overload of features and consolidate them
· Foresee a first release with a sufficient feature set to allow migration to the new C4D by the end of August, making sure it will be implemented in an unambiguous, user-friendly manner. The feature set will be extended in subsequent iterations by the end of 2010
The main features of the new platform are:
Groupware with :
o Document sharing
o Blogs
o Events
o Mini website
o Private and public groups
o Notifications
· Personal dashboard with
o Your profile
o Your groups
o Your interests
· Topic pages
· Magazine articles, including video
· Platform members with facetted search
· Drupal 6 was used to build the future C4D platform.
· Functionalities were built as features. A feature combines content type(s), views (list of content), blocks, configuration and customization in a module. This makes it possible to install and enable a complete set of functionalities at once.
· The requested functionalities were be created as much as possible by combining existing modules.
· The amount of modules was limited to improve site performance and make future developments and improvements of the site easier. Priority will be given to modules that can cover a number of functionalities at once.
· All platform functionality were built with reuse in mind
The group functionalities were based on the Open Atrium framework.
